BlueLine Urban Park Project Underway in Arlington

With the help of BlueLine’s real estate expertise, a private landowner overcame decades of lawsuits among government agencies to convey a property for a public water-sports activities on the Potomac River.

Years of lawsuits and development proposals surrounded a uniquely located parcel at the gateway to Key Bridge along the Potomac River in Arlington, Va.  Private landowners asked BlueLine Conservation to create a conservation based solution to enable sale of the property.  Through tripartite negotiations with The Conservation Fund, Northern Virginia Conservation Trust, and Arlington County, BlueLine (through its affiliate Norman Realty) successfully brokered the sale of the property to Arlington, for a proposed rowing river access and support facility.  Though construction will not begin for several years, the project is now a certainty.
